The conflict in Afghanistan is driving large numbers to make a perilous journey to Europe for safety and shelter.
Turkey has detained a boat carrying more than 230 people in the Aegean Sea.
Officials believe the group of mainly Afghans were on their way to Italy.
Many Afghans are looking for a way out amid rising violence in Afghanistan.
Turkish authorities detained about 1,500 migrants last week trying to reach the country through Iran.

Al Jazeera's Sinem Koseoglu reports from the city of Van near the border.
